Mystery for Hire will present the murder-mystery “Politics Can Be Murder” at 7 p.m. Saturday, April 14 and May 12, at Marco’s Restaurant in Lewiston. The original script, written by Dan Marois of Poland Spring, revolves around the Senate campaign of incumbent Warren Hardstuff, who is being challenged by Hilton Paris III. Tickets are $36.95 per person, which includes a full buffet, mystery show, tax and gratuity. Tickets must be purchased in advance by calling Marco’s at 783-0336.
